file { "/etc/mailname":
ensure => present,
content => "${fqdn}\n",
+ seltype => "postfix_etc_t",
}
# Aliases
ensure => present,
content => "# file managed by puppet\n",
replace => false,
+ seltype => "postfix_etc_t",
notify => Exec["newaliases"],
}
file {"${name}":
ensure => $ensure,
mode => 600,
+ seltype => "postfix_etc_t",
}
file {"${name}.db":
ensure => $ensure,
mode => 600,
require => [File["${name}"], Exec["generate ${name}.db"]],
+ seltype => "postfix_etc_t",
}
exec {"generate ${name}.db":